American actress Angelina Jolie said Sunday she no longer recognises her country, voicing concern over threats to free expression while presenting her latest film at Spain's San Sebastian film festival.
Her comments come as worries grow over free speech in the United States, after President Donald Trumps crackdown on critical media and the recent suspension of late-night host Jimmy Kimmels show over comments on the killing of conservative influencer Charlie Kirk.
I love my country, but I dont at this time recognise my country, Jolie said when asked if she feared for freedom of speech in the United States.
